Monroe blends in-town neighborhoods with acreage and small farms out toward the valley. Land, outbuildings and well/septic details drive the financing conversation here.

What to know about financing in Monroe

  • Acreage properties need appraisers who can support land value with comparable sales.
  • Well and septic properties have specific FHA, VA and USDA requirements.
  • USDA financing with zero down is realistic on many rural-designated addresses.

Snohomish County details that affect your payment

  • Snohomish County sits inside the Seattle-Tacoma-Bellevue high-cost area, so the conforming loan limit is set above the national baseline, many purchases that look like jumbo money still qualify for conventional high-balance pricing.
  • A large share of the county's inventory is 1990s-and-newer single family, which keeps appraisals and FHA/VA property conditions relatively straightforward compared with older housing stock.
  • Property taxes are billed by the county treasurer and collected through your escrow account; I include the actual parcel figure in your payment estimate instead of a flat percentage guess.

Monroe mortgage questions

Can I finance acreage near Monroe?
Yes, though the appraisal has to support the land value and outbuildings. I match the file to a lender program that handles acreage well.
What about well and septic?
Financeable, with inspections and, on government loans, specific distance and potability requirements we handle inside the escrow timeline.
